U.S. Job Corps- A student's Perspective (Non-fiction)
I've been going thru this school for a while and I wonder if my journals are going to reach the people who actually need the information to make an educated decision on whether or not it will work for them. I gotta say all things considered for most people I don't recommend it, for the reasons contained herein, however I'm not about to outright say this program can do no good.
If you are a U.S. Resident between the ages of 16 and 24, and aren't sure what you're going to do with your life because of poverty, homelessness and so on, Job Corps may be something that can help you. But if you're in that same age bracket and doing alright, maybe not great but you're not in debt at least, then be careful because it has equal potential to hurt those who have other options.
